"The room is on the 10th floor of a very broken apartment building, there is no sign outside, you can navigate on Google Maps. The elevator is very broken and needs to wait, but after entering the Youth Hostel, I was pleasantly surprised. The interior is very beautiful and new except for the taste of a little newly renovated. You can see the city view in the lounge. The address location is also very good. It is a 10-minute walk from the old Ebo and a half-hour taxi ride from the new Ebo. Staff is warm, service is very good, English is fluent, you can wash clothes (5 pounds each with drying), you can store your luggage, you can buy water (5 pounds in small bottles, 10 pounds in large bottles) The disadvantage is that the room is very noisy, like sleeping on the street, it is recommended to book a twin room and sleep on the one far from the window... or wear headphones, it is really noisy and noisy, but it is very beautiful haha. All in all, it is a very cost-effective choice!"

This Marriott hotel is located in Cairo Airport's Terminal 3, which is incredibly convenient. It's only a five-minute walk from the hotel to the airport via a dedicated elevator and skywalk. We arrived much earlier than our check-in time, but they were able to accommodate us without any extra charge. The staff in the lobby were all very friendly and helpful, and they even had Chinese-speaking staff available!
